(C) We delivered ref A statement October 28 to Bernard Chappedelaine, the MFA's Iraq desk officer, and also asked him if France would not consider any additional bilateral programs for Iraq, given the approval of the referendum on the constitution. Chappedelaine raised the long-standing French gendarme offer, but did not offer any additional suggestions. He said France was interested in the new Arab League initiative (ref B) and had heard that Secretary General Amr Moussa's recent trip to Iraq was positive. An informal translation of the MFA's press statement is at para ¶2. ¶2. (U) Informal translation of MFA Press Statement (October 26, 2005): "Following the publication of the October 15 referendum results by the Iraqi independent electoral commission, we applaud the active participation of Iraqis in this vote, which led to the approval of the constitution. The Iraqi political process should continue, in accordance with resolution 1546, with the holding of legislative elections on December 15. It is essential that the mobilization of the electorate, which occurred for the referendum, lead to a true national dialogue that includes all members of Iraqi society. The next steps will necessitate more than ever the gathering together of all efforts, inside and outside Iraq, in order to bring peace and stability to this country and to guarantee its sovereignty and unity."
